Column Value To Column Header?

Hello,

I have the following table:

 

ID, CODE, VALUE

44, AAA, 1
44, BBB, 1
44, CCC, 1
44, DDD, 1
45, AAA, 2
45, BBB, 2

I’d like to have the following output:

ID, AAA, BBB, CCC, DDD

44,   1       1,       1,       1
45,   2       2

 

Is there a way to do this in Power BI?

1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ION
johnt75
Super User
Super User

In Power Query select the Code column then from the Transform section of the ribbon choose Pivot Column and choose the VALUE column to provide the values.
